Finding the Right Chef: What to Look For
The first step is research. Start by searching online for “private chefs Cayman Islands” or “personal chefs Grand Cayman.” Look for chefs with positive reviews and testimonials from previous clients. Websites like Cayman Good Taste and Explore Cayman are great resources for finding reputable culinary professionals. You can also ask your vacation rental property manager for recommendations – they often have partnerships with local chefs.
Once you’ve identified a few potential candidates, it’s essential to review their credentials and experience. Look for chefs with formal culinary training, such as degrees from recognized culinary schools like Le Cordon Bleu. Experience working in fine-dining restaurants or hotels is also a plus. Don’t hesitate to ask for references from previous clients – a reputable chef will be happy to provide them.
Before making a final decision, schedule a consultation with the chef to discuss your needs and preferences. This is an opportunity to get to know the chef’s personality and culinary style. Discuss your dietary requirements, desired cuisine, and budget. Ask to see sample menus or request a custom menu based on your specific tastes. This meeting is crucial to ensure that the chef is the right fit for your needs and preferences.
Navigating the Costs: Understanding Private Chef Pricing
The cost of hiring a private chef in the Cayman Islands can vary widely depending on several factors, including the number of guests, the complexity of the menu, the length of the service, and the chef’s experience and reputation. Generally, you can expect to pay anywhere from $100 to $300+ per person per meal. This usually includes the cost of groceries, preparation, cooking, and cleanup. Some chefs may charge an additional fee for travel or special requests.
It’s important to get a clear breakdown of all costs upfront, including any potential hidden fees. Ask the chef for a detailed proposal outlining the menu, the number of guests, the total cost, and the payment terms. Most chefs will require a deposit to secure your booking, with the remaining balance due after the service is completed.

The Booking Process: Securing Your Culinary Experience
Once you’ve chosen your chef and agreed to the terms, the booking process is fairly straightforward. Most chefs will require a signed contract outlining the details of the service, including the date, time, location, menu, and cost. Be sure to read the contract carefully before signing it to ensure that you understand all the terms and conditions.
Provide the chef with as much information as possible about your preferences, dietary restrictions, and any special requests. The more information you provide, the better the chef will be able to tailor the experience to your needs. Confirm the final menu and guest count a few days before the event. This will give the chef ample time to purchase the necessary ingredients and prepare for your meal.
On the day of the event, simply relax and let the chef take care of everything. Most chefs will arrive a few hours before the scheduled meal time to set up and prepare the food. They’ll handle all the cooking, serving, and cleanup, leaving you free to enjoy your vacation. FAQ Section
What if I have allergies or dietary restrictions?
Be sure to communicate any dietary restrictions or allergies to the chef well in advance. Provide as much detail as possible, including specific ingredients to avoid and any preferred alternatives. A professional chef can adapt menus and suggest substitutions to accommodate almost any dietary needs.
How far in advance should I book a private chef?
It’s recommended to book as far in advance as possible, especially during peak season (December to April). Popular chefs can book up weeks or even months in advance. Booking early will also give you more time to discuss your menu and preferences with the chef.
What happens if I need to cancel my booking?
Cancellation policies vary from chef to chef. Be sure to review the cancellation policy in the contract before signing it. Generally, you may be able to receive a full or partial refund if you cancel within a certain timeframe. However, if you cancel close to the event date, you may forfeit your deposit.
Is it customary to tip a private chef?
Tipping is not always expected but is always appreciated for exceptional service. A tip of 15-20% is customary, especially if the chef went above and beyond to meet your needs. However, some chefs may include a service charge in their total cost, so be sure to clarify this beforehand.
Can a private chef accommodate large groups?
Yes, many private chefs are equipped to handle large groups. However, it’s important to discuss the guest count and menu complexity with the chef in advance. They may need to bring in additional staff to assist with preparation and service. Be prepared to pay a higher price for larger groups.
